NVIDIA's success builds on a foundation of industry leading hardware. Achieving that distinction involves extensive design optimization, including combining the best of EDA with highly sophisticated, large scale internal CAD tools. Our team develops these tools by fusing advances in parallel computing, machine learning, and VLSI hardware design.

We are seeking an innovative CAD Software Developer with particular interest in algorithms for floor planning, macro placement, global routing, and related physical design optimization. This position broadly spans all levels of development from computational geometry to graph optimization and visualization. What you’ll be doing:

  • Invent and optimize new methods for floor planning and chip-level optimization tools.
  • Improve designer insight and visualization by extending GUIs built on Qt and/or OpenGL.
  • Develop machine learning strategies to improve efficiency of design space exploration.
  • As with any software engineering team, we do write a lot of code, but this is broader than a typical CAD or EDA role. Instead, we as a team own the whole process from discovery and invention of new optimization opportunities, developing solutions, and working directly inside design teams to facilitate deployment. Team members enjoy considerable flexibility in defining new projects and exploring new technical domains due to the breadth of our team's role.

What we need to see:

  • BS, MS, PhD or equivalent in Electrical Engineering or Computer Science
  • Strength in both CAD software and VLSI hardware design
  • 8+ years’ experience in software development with C++
  • Good understanding of computational geometry and graph theory
  • Familiarity with VLSI floorplan concepts such as routability, congestion, and partitioning
  • Expertise in algorithm development for physical design, analysis, and visualization
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ills

Ways to stand out from the crowd:

  • C++17/C++14 experience, such as lambdas and concurrency
  • Experience and/or interest in GUI development using Qt or OpenGL
  • Deep understanding of algorithm design principles such as complexity analysis, efficient memory and I/O use, etc.
  • In general, an obsession with performance and the practical skills to build highly innovative software for world leading hardware
